Air containment systems designed to maximize cooling predictability, capacity, and efficiency The APC Thermal Containment products maximize the effectiveness of InRow cooling solutions for low to high density racked IT loads. Available in rack or aisle level configurations, these products are designed to completely separate the supply and return air paths of the IT equipment. Ideal for any IT environment, the air separation ensures the warmest possible air is being returned to the InRow cooling units, which further increases the efficiency, capacity, and predictability of the cooling system. Thermal containment is available for 300mm, 600mm, 750mm wide NetShelter Racks, UPS/PDU, and InRow Cooling products. Front containment can also be added to the rack configuration for additional isolation and noise dampening.  APC Thermal Containment Airflow Diagram
Deployment of high density loads in IT environments can create areas of unpredictable cooling performance. APC's Thermal Containment or Rack Air Containment is a modular system designed to work in conjunction with APC NetShelter SX enclosures and InRow cooling units to provide maximum cooling predictability, capacity, and efficiency. By attaching to the rear of the NetShelter SX, air exhausted from IT equipment is forced to pass through the cooling unit where it is conditioned. This ensures that warm exhaust air does not find its way back to the air inlets of installed servers. N+1 and 2N configurations allow for maximum availability.

The APC Thermal Containment offers many benefits: Availability:- Cable access brush strip- Blocks air from escaping through holes surrounding cabling.
- Redundancy Systems can be configured to included an additional InRow cooling unit to provide N+1 or 2N redundancy.
- Integrated pressure sensors- Pressure sensors in the InRow cooling units provide fan speed control for optimum system efficiency.
Convenience - Noise dampening- Containment of both front and rear provides reduction of noise caused by installed equipment.
- Plexiglass door inserts- Provides required air containment and a consistent look across the racks while allowing visibility to installed IT equipment.
- Easy to install- Innovative design allows for fast, easy installation by almost anybody.
Agility: - Ceiling tiles- Closes off the top of the hot aisle to prevent warm air from mixing with room air.
- One-way locking door- Secures the hot aisle while allowing for quick exit in case of emergency.
- Scaleable densities- Allows for higher cooling to be achieved by integrating the Hot Aisle Containment System with row-based architecture.
- Modular design- Modular design provides scalable solutions to add cooling as demand increases.
Adaptability - Modular design- Compatible with standard NetShelter SX racks, providing maximum system flexibility and scalability.
- Front containment- Ensures cold supply air is not captured by neighboring equipment.
- Rear containment- Ensures server exhaust air is returned to the InRow cooling units for maximum cooling predictability.
